The Teva Women's Canyonview RP Hiking Shoe in Dark Gull Grey/Burlwood is engineered for those who crave adventure yet desire a chic look even on city streets. This shoe seamlessly transitions from urban environments to rugged landscapes, making it a reliable choice for casual hikers. With a waterproof leather upper and Teva's unique RAPIDproof bootie, you can trust that your feet will remain dry, enhancing your overall outdoor experience.

Comfort: The Canyonview RP excels in comfort, boasting an EVA sockliner and RMAT/Float-Lite midsole that cushions your every step. Whether you're walking on pavement or hiking through trails, your feet will thank you after a day of wear.
Design: Its low-profile silhouette makes it stylish enough for casual outings while functional enough for light hikes. The color combination of Dark Gull Grey and Burlwood adds a touch of sophistication, appealing to fashion-conscious consumers.
Durability: Constructed with a waterproof leather upper and a robust rubber outsole, this shoe is built to withstand varied conditions, ensuring longevity whether on rocky paths or smooth sidewalks. It's a product designed with the adventurous spirit in mind.
Versatility: Arguably one of its strongest points, the Canyonview RP is perfect for transitioning easily between daily errands and outdoor excursions. It serves well for day hikes but is also suited for leisurely strolls around town.

I didn't see any reviews for these shoes last week so here goes.I saw these shoes in person at Macy's last Monday and thought they might be just right for an upcoming trip that will involve city walking, trail walking and possibly rain. They look appropriately low-key for city walking - mostly because they are a dull gray without stripes or contrast.My feet are kind of wide. Not usually W width but almost. I ordered my usual size, 8M, and they fit my semi-wide feet just fine.Teva calls them hiking shoes and they do feel more like hiking/walking shoes than sneakers. They have a firmness to them. I'm guessing they will become a little more flexible as I break them in. We'll see. Also, I noticed after my walk yesterday that my socks were slightly damp with sweat, which I am attributing to their being waterproof. But I thought I would mention it just in case.I'm glad I bought them. They are comfortable (but not squishy) and should be versatile.
These are really cute and they seem to be very sturdy and well-made. My only complaint is that they don’t have all that much arch support which surprises me since they are Teva brand. Luckily, the insoles are removable so I took them out and put some Dr. Scholl’s arch support insoles inside and now they feel much better. I definitely recommend these shoes but you might have to do the same thing I did.
